EX-10.9 32 a2139363zex-10_9.txt EX-10.9 Exhibit 10.9 [EXECUTION COPY] FIRST AMENDMENT, ACKNOWLEDGMENT AND SUPPLEMENT TO UNIT PURCHASE AGREEMENT This First Amendment, Acknowledgment and Supplement to Unit Purchase Agreement (this "AMENDMENT AND SUPPLEMENT"), dated as of April 6, 2004, is made to the Unit Purchase Agreement (the "AGREEMENT"), dated as of February 6, 2004, by and among Medtech/Denorex, LLC, a Delaware limited liability company (n/k/a Prestige International Holdings, LLC, the "COMPANY"), GTCR Fund VIII, L.P., a Delaware limited partnership, GTCR Fund VIII/B, L.P., a Delaware limited partnership, GTCR Co-Invest II, L.P., a Delaware limited partnership, and the TCW/Crescent Purchasers (as defined therein). Each capitalized term used herein but not otherwise defined shall have the meaning ascribed to such term in the Agreement. WHEREAS, the Company is indirectly acquiring all of the outstanding shares of capital stock of Bonita Bay Holdings, Inc., a Virginia corporation and ultimate parent of Prestige Brands International, Inc. (the "ACQUISITION"); and WHEREAS, in connection with the Acquisition and in order to better reflect the intent of the parties, the undersigned desire to amend certain terms of the Agreement, add GTCR Capital Partners (as defined below) as a party to the Agreement, make certain acknowledgments with respect to the Agreement and reaffirm the other terms and provisions of the Agreement; and WHEREAS, pursuant to Section 1.B of the Agreement (as amended hereby), the Purchasers (as defined in this Amendment and Supplement) desire to purchase, and the Company desires to sell to the Purchasers, 58,179.25 Class B Preferred Units for an aggregate purchase price of $58,179,250. NOW, THEREFORE, effective immediately prior to the consummation of the Acquisition (with respect to the amendments provided herein) or simultaneous to the consummation of the Acquisition (with respect to the purchase of Class B Preferred Units described herein), the undersigned, intending to be legally bound, hereby agree as follows: AMENDMENT PROVISIONS 1. Pursuant to Section 1.B(d) of the Agreement (as amended pursuant to this Amendment and Supplement), the Company has authorized the issuance and sale to the Purchasers on the date hereof of 58,179.250 Class B Preferred Units, having the rights and preferences set forth in the LLC Agreement. 11. At the Subsequent Closing, subject to the terms and conditions set forth herein, for an aggregate purchase price of $58,179,250 (i) GTCR Fund VIII shall purchase from the Company, and the Company shall sell to GTCR Fund VIII, 46,643.166 Class B Preferred Units at a price of $1,000 per unit, (ii) GTCR Fund VIII/B shall purchase from the Company, and the Company shall sell to GTCR Fund VIII/B, 8,185.659 Class B Preferred Units at a price of $1,000 per unit; (iii) GTCR Co-Invest shall purchase from the Company, and the Company shall sell to GTCR Co-Invest, 248.952 Class B Preferred Units at a price of $1,000 per unit; (iv) GTCR Capital Partners shall purchase from the Company, and the Company shall sell to GTCR Capital Partners, 1,485.040 Class B Preferred Units at a price of $1,000 per unit; and (v) the TCW/Crescent Purchasers shall purchase from the Company, and the Company shall sell to the TCW/Crescent Purchasers, 1,616.433 Class B Preferred Units at a price of $1,000 per unit. 12. The Subsequent Closing contemplated by Section 11 above shall occur in connection with, and concurrent with, the consummation of the Acquisition. At such Subsequent Closing, the Company shall deliver to each Purchaser one or more unit certificates evidencing the Class B Preferred Units to be purchased by such Purchaser, registered in such Purchaser's name, upon payment of the purchase price thereof by wire transfer of immediately available funds to such account as designated by the Company. 5 13.
